Ok so i have posted several times without much luck about the clanking noise i have been getting everytime i start off in reverse or 1st doestn matter. It even does it when i downshift. Well, now i found it does it even with the clutch pushed all the way in! I was pulling into my parking spot at home and i have to drive over uneven levels of concrete to get into it, and i had the clutch pushed in just coasting. As i hit the bump the car kinda rocked a little and that smae noise happened! As the car rocked left-right-left, the noise went clank-creeeek-clank. What the heck is that? The clutch was in to the floor, so the drive train should not have been catching on anyresistance, it was just the bump. Also i notice, i start moving about a foot or two before it makes the clank when i stop and start again. Its delayed. What else could it be? Its definitely not right its too loud. My buddies mustang is onlya year newer but it has 140k miles on it and it doesnt make any noise like that at all. Help! I dont have a clue!

Probably a bad or worn/cracked bushing. Check motor mounts, tranny mounts, and double check drive shaft u-joints while your under there. Could also be a swaybar bushing, or bad shock mount bushing.
